  Fig. 5. Validation of Hex targets in Xenopus embryos. (A) Expression of candidate Hex target genes in response to depleting endogenous Hex. In situ hybridisation for Xtle4, Xnr1, Xnr2, Xnr5 and Xnr6 in Hex MO depleted and rescued embryos. Embryos were injected as in Fig. 1F with the indicated MO/RNA combination and analysed by in situ hybridisation at stage 10.5. Where CHX is indicated, embryos were transferred to media containing CHX before MBT and collected 90 minutes later for fixation. As CHX slightly delays development, some of these embryos do not present evident dorsal lips. (B) Expression of candidate Hex target genes in response to Hex-λVP2. In situ hybridisation of embryos injected with Hex-λVP2 and assayed for the expression of the same set of candidate genes as in A. Embryos were injected at the four-cell stage on the dorsal side alongside nucGFP RNA. Embryos were bisected for better observation of the internal expression. Dorsal is towards the right.
